Revolutionizing The Pharma Industry: The Power Of Freeze Dryers

In the world of pharmaceuticals, Freeze Dryers have become an indispensable tool for drug manufacturers These innovative machines have revolutionized the way medications are preserved and stored, ensuring their efficacy and stability over time In this article, we will delve into the importance of Freeze Dryers in the pharma industry and how they have transformed the way drugs are produced and distributed.

Freeze drying, also known as lyophilization, is a process that involves removing moisture from products by freezing them and then subjecting them to a vacuum environment The result is a dry and stable product that has a longer shelf life compared to traditional drying methods Freeze Dryers are essential for the pharmaceutical industry as they help preserve the potency and efficacy of drugs by removing water content without compromising their chemical composition.

One of the main advantages of using Freeze Dryers in the pharma industry is the ability to store drugs at room temperature without the need for refrigeration This not only reduces storage costs but also makes it easier to transport medications to different locations without the risk of temperature variations affecting their quality This is particularly important for vaccines and biologics that are sensitive to temperature fluctuations and require strict storage conditions to remain effective.

Another crucial benefit of Freeze Dryers is their ability to preserve the stability of drugs over time By removing moisture from the product, Freeze Dryers prevent the growth of bacteria, mold, and other contaminants that can compromise the integrity of medications This ensures that drugs retain their potency and efficacy even after prolonged storage, making them more reliable for patients and healthcare providers.
